a Drawn to Engineering comic for Chemical Engineering Education

Worst-Case Scenario
written by Luke Landherr
drawn by Maki Naro

Panel 1
STUDENT working on a computer. Smoke in the background.

STUDENT: โ€ฆ actually, if I just enter in the right prompts, I can get this AI tool to solve all this work for me!

STUDENT: And thatโ€™s before I even get into any writing assignmentsโ€ฆ

STUDENT: The professor will probably want more accurate answers, after all.

Panel 2:

PROFESSOR working on a computer. Smoke rising from fire in a green hilled background.

PROFESSOR: So thereโ€™s all these problems to write and this student work to review, butโ€ฆ

PROFESSOR: โ€ฆ actually, I could just feed this AI tool the right prompts and have it do the curriculum design and evaluations for me!

PROFESSOR: The students will probably appreciate unique problems and faster feedback, after all.
